About Chelsea Ellis

Chelsea Ellis is an attorney with expertise in international trade, economic sanctions, and export control laws. She has advised both foreign investors and U.S. businesses on compliance with CFIUS requirements and has experience in designing compliance programs and conducting audits.

Background

Chelsea Ellis has served in various legal roles throughout her career. She worked as an Attorney at the Executive Office of the President, Office of the U.S. Trade Representative, where she contributed to trade policy and compliance. Prior to that, she was an Associate at Ziliak Law, LLC, and LimNexus LLP. Chelsea also gained experience as a FinTech Legal Analyst at E&S Group, where she focused on legal issues related to financial technology.

Achievements

Chelsea Ellis has a track record of advising clients on compliance with UN, U.S., and other sanctions and export control laws. She has prepared and filed voluntary disclosures to mitigate potential penalties from government agencies. Chelsea has successfully filed delisting petitions for clients to be removed from OFAC’s Specially Designated Nationals (SDN) List and has applied for OFAC unblocking requests and specific licenses across various sectors. She has also participated as a panelist on topics related to OFAC/BIS Licensing and Sanctions Risk Management.
